A Service for Mid-Day Prayers

(It is customary at Brotherhood meetings to pause at noon for prayers, especially for missions and missionary work. The Order on page 103 of the Prayer Book or the following maybe used.)

ALL: The BROTHERHOOD COLLECT (all standing)
Almighty God, who gave such grace to your apostle Andrew that he readily obeyed the call of your Son Jesus Christ, and brought his brother with him: Give us, who are called by your Holy Word, grace to follow him without delay, and to bring those near to us into his gracious presence; who lives and reigns with you and the Holy Spirit, one God, now and forever. Amen.

LEADER:
O God, make speed to save us.

MEMBERS:
O Lord, make haste to help us.

Glory to the Father, and to the Son, and to the Holy Spirit: as it was in the beginning, is now, and will be for ever. Amen.

LEADER (V) and MEMBERS (R): (From Psalm 113)

VGive praise, you servants of the Lord; *
R praise the name of the Lord.
VLet the name of the Lord be blessed, *
Rfrom this time forth for evermore.
VFrom the rising of the sun to its going down *
Rlet the Name of the Lord be praised.
VThe Lord is high above all nations, *
Rand his glory above the heavens

LEADER or ASSIGNED MEMBER A Reading
O God, you will keep in perfect peace those whose minds are fixed upon you; for in returning and rest we shall be saved; in quietness and trust shall be our strength. Isaiah 26:3,30:15

ALL: The Lord's Prayer
Our Father, who art in heaven, hallowed be thy Name, thy kingdom come, thy will be done. on earth as it is in heaven. Give us this day our daily bread. and forgive us our trespasses, as we forgive those
who trespass against us. And lead us not into temptation, but deliver us from evil. For thine is the kingdom, and the power, and the glory, for ever and ever. Amen.

LEADER:
Heavenly Father, send your Holy Spirit into our hearts, to direct and rule us according to your will, to comfort us in all our afflictions, to defend us from all error, and to lead us into all truth; through Jesus Christ our Lord. Amen.

LEADER:
Blessed Savior, at this hour you hung upon the cross, stretching out your loving arms: Grant that all peoples of the earth may look to you and be saved; for your tender mercies' sake. Amen.

LEADER:
Almighty Savior, who at noonday called your servant Saint Paul to be an apostle to the Gentiles: We pray you to illumine the world with the radiance of your glory, that all nations may come and worship you; for you live and reign for ever and ever. Amen.

ALL:
Almighty God, who gave to your servant Andrew boldness to confess the Name of our Savior Jesus Christ before the rulers of this world, and courage to die for this faith; Grant that we may always be ready to give a reason for the hope that is in us, and to suffer gladly for the sake of our Lord Jesus Christ; who lives and reigns with you and the Holy Spirit, one God, forever and ever. Amen.

LEADER:
Let us bless the Lord.

ALL:
Thanks be to God.
